Ex-air steward and two Nepali men charged with kidnap

They demanded a ransom of 10 gold bars for the release of company director.

A former air steward and two Nepali construction workers were charged in the Magistrate’s Court here today with kidnapping a security company director and demanding a ransom of 10 gold bars worth RM1.44 million, early this month.

C. Rudhra, 37, from Taman Klang Utama here, and the two Nepali workers, R.Roshan and T.J. Ramesh, both aged 29, are alleged to have abducted the company director, A.Kanapathy, 64, near a restaurant in Persiaran Raja Muda Musa, hereat about 9.30am on March 7.

The charge under Section 3 of the Kidnapping Act 1961, read together with Section 34 of the Penal Code, carries the death penalty or life imprisonment and whipping upon conviction.

No plea was recorded after the charge was read before Magistrate Liew Horng Bin.  The court fixed April 25 for remention of the case. Deputy public prosecutor Puteri Iskandariah Md Tahir appeared for the prosecution, while only Rudhra was represented by lawyer KS. Rathakrishnan.
